Personally I don't totally mind when a repeat character appears in the character packs, especially a rarer one like Blooper, Bramball or the Cat Goombas. Most "real" Mario levels tend to have a lot of multiples of the same enemy, so being able to populate a level with a bunch of similar enemies helps to maintain a coherent theme. Parts-wise, Bramball is also so far the only character who has had that thorny vine piece, which could be useful in other sorts of MOCs.

On the note of "repeat" enemies, a part of me hopes that the Biddybud/Para-Biddybud appears in more colors in the future. In the games it originates from, it often tends to appear in groups of multiple colors, so perhaps a future character pack could have a pair of differently colored Biddybuds (maybe yellow and blue) like the two Cat Goombas in this pack. One nice thing about the character packs getting larger is that not only can larger characters like Spike and Sumo Bro be included now, but multiple smaller enemies can be packaged together too!

Charging Chuck would be awesome! Fishbone too though I'm not sure how you'd best achieve that skeletal shape and still have room for a scannable tile. Another enemy I'd like to see (especially now that we have more snow levels) is a Snow Pokey. And a Snow Spike, for that matter.

A lot of the more traditional/recurring enemy types have been covered, but there are still many that haven't—especially when you get into enemies that have only been in a couple games. In more recent games, there's a lot of 3D Land/3D World enemies in particular that have yet to be made in Lego. There's also a lot of enemies that belong mainly to particular spinoffs/subseries, like enemies largely from the Yoshi's Island or Super Mario Galaxy games, and many variants of enemies that have been made (like the bright red Bulls-Eye Bills or Para-bones as well as bigger versions of enemies like Cheep Cheeps or Fuzzies). I'd also love to see some more large boss characters, especially Gooper Blooper and Petey Piranha (two of the bosses from Sunshine who have gone on to appear relatively frequently in some of the spin-off games).

I would expect a character like Luma that's iconic to Galaxy specifically to be released in a set or wave of sets alongside other characters from that game like Rosalina, maybe even (if we're lucky) in a set based on a Galaxy location like the Comet Observatory. I don't really feel like they'd be ideally suited to a character pack—especially since I'm not sure what interaction they ought to have other than a generic "friendly" interaction like Toads.

Speaking of Toads and Galaxy, I think the recolors we've gotten so far do mean we can build almost the whole Toad Brigade apart from Captain Toad himself!
